Understanding Web Continuity
Implementing web continuity involves several key strategies. Organizations often use redundant hosting environments, geographically dispersed data centers, and content delivery networks CDNs to distribute traffic and content. Failover mechanisms automatically redirect users to backup sites or servers if the primary system fails. Regular testing of these systems is crucial to ensure they function as expected during an actual incident. For instance, a financial institution might use web continuity to ensure customers can always access their banking portal, even if one data center experiences an outage or a DDoS attack.
Responsibility for web continuity typically falls under IT operations and cybersecurity teams, often overseen by a business continuity steering committee. Effective governance requires clear policies, regular risk assessments, and defined recovery time objectives RTOs and recovery point objectives RPOs. The strategic importance lies in protecting brand reputation, maintaining customer trust, and ensuring critical business functions remain available. Failure to implement robust web continuity plans can lead to significant financial losses, regulatory penalties, and long-term damage to an organization's public image.

Web continuity ensures uninterrupted access to web applications and data during outages. It typically involves redundant infrastructure, such as geographically dispersed data centers and load balancing. When a primary system fails, traffic is automatically rerouted to a backup system. This process often uses DNS redirection or global server load balancing GSLB to seamlessly switch users to an active secondary environment. The goal is to minimize downtime and maintain user experience even during significant disruptions. This proactive approach prevents service interruptions from impacting business operations.
Implementing web continuity requires careful planning, regular testing, and ongoing maintenance. Organizations must define recovery point objectives RPO and recovery time objectives RTO to guide their strategy. Integration with incident response plans ensures a coordinated approach during an actual event. Regular drills validate the effectiveness of the continuity solution and identify areas for improvement. Governance policies dictate how changes are managed and how the system is monitored for optimal performance and resilience.
